accept |
to say yes when someone wants to give you something. |
allergy |
a reaction of your body to some substance that causes the feeling of illness. Common allergies are to animal hair, dust, pollen, and certain foods such as nuts. |
cabin |
a small house, built in a simple or rough way. |
drunk |
having had too much alcohol to drink. |
gang |
a group of people who do things together. These things may be just for fun or may involve crime. |
hot |
holding or giving off great heat. |
library |
a place in a town or school where you can borrow books, recorded music, and other materials. |
model |
a small copy of something. |
observe |
to notice or see. |
outside |
the outer side or surface. |
poison |
a substance that can kill or seriously harm living beings if it is swallowed, breathed, or taken in. |
scientist |
a person who works in or studies a science. |
tease |
to make fun of or try to annoy in a playful or cruel way. |
trouble |
serious difficulty. |
victory |
success in a game or war. |
